WebFeb 21, 2024 · Eating flax seeds soaked in water is an easy and healthy way to get the benefits of flax seeds. Start by soaking 1/4 cup of flax seeds in 1 cup of water for 8-10 hours. Once soaked, strain the flax seeds in a fine-mesh strainer and rinse with cold water. You can either eat the soaked flax seeds as is, or add them to your favorite smoothie or ... Proteins. 4 grams. Fat. 10 grams. Two tablespoons of flaxseeds also provide eight percent of your daily value (DV) of iron and six percent DV of calcium. Flaxseeds contain a good amount of healthy fats, particularly omega-3 fatty acids, as well as fibrous compounds called lignans.
